FIRST TEAM – VS CATALANS DRAGONS (H) – FRIDAY 12th MAY 2023

Castleford’s First Team return home after a disappointing night at the Leigh Sports Village where the Leopards ran away with the contest in the second half last Friday night.
The Dragons are coming off an impressive victory against reigning champions St Helens at the Stade Gilbert Brutus where tries from Mourgue, Ikuvalu, and a double from Davies helped them to a 24-12 success.
Friday will mark the second time the pair have met this campaign with the Fords pushing the Dragons all the way, falling just short at the start of April. A stunning Jack Broadbent try was the Tigers' highlight that day and a golden point-winning drop goal from Danny Richardson provided one of the moments of the season against Catalans at The Jungle last year.

RESERVES – VS BRADFORD BULLS (A) – SATURDAY 13th MAY 2023

The Tigers Reserves will be looking to respond when they head to Horsfall Stadium on Saturday after a narrow loss in their previous fixture.
Scott Murrell’s men pushed unbeaten St Helens until the bitter end last time out away from home with Ryan Joseph scoring twice, as well as Oliver Burton, and Bailey Dawson scoring late but they were edged out by 28 points to 22.
Cas will take many positives from that day and will have their sights set on returning to winning ways with kick-off in Bradford pencilled in for 12pm.
WOMEN – NINES FESTIVAL – SUNDAY 14th MAY 2023

The Tigresses will take part in this year's Women's Rugby League Nines which will return to Victoria Park, Warrington this weekend after a thrilling inaugural tournament in 2022!
Castleford will take on Wigan Warriors, Leigh Leopards, and London Broncos over the day with the action getting underway from 10:30am.

PDRL – BRADFORD FESTIVAL – SUNDAY 14th MAY 2023

Our PDRL stars return to action this week after winning both of their fixtures at last month’s festival hosted by Leeds Rhinos.
Impressive victories over both Hull sides see them head into Sunday’s matches full of confidence as the sport continues to go from strength to strength.
The Tigers take on Warrington for a 11am kick-off before taking on rivals Wakefield at 12pm at Tong Leadership Academy in Bradford.
